Position Summary
The Simulation Coordinator provides comprehensive operational technical and educational support for simulation-based learning across the establishing programs on the Charlotte campus. This role supports a growing technology-forward simulation center that includes six high-fidelity simulators (Elevate Health) full audiovisual capture capabilities and additional technology as it adopted. Working collaboratively with SHS faculty program leadership and simulation leadership the Simulation Coordinator ensures high-quality compliant with Society for Simulation in Healthcare standards for simulation education and learner-centered simulation experiences aligned with current Healthcare Simulation Standards of Best Practice.

Job Duties
- Simulation Operations & Technology
- Set up operate maintain and troubleshoot high-fidelity simulators task trainers virtual reality and procedural trainers and hospital-type clinical equipment.
- Manage simulation-related AV/IT systems including recording playback and data capture.
- Prepare simulation spaces including equipment supplies moulage and room configuration.
- Develop and maintain simulator checklists troubleshooting guides and preventive maintenance plans.
- Coordinate with vendors to address technical issues repairs upgrades and maintenance needs.
- Educational & Programmatic Support
- Collaborate with PA CMHC and SHS faculty to conduct simulation needs assessments and align activities with course and program outcomes.
- Assist in the design execution and modification of simulation scenarios including appropriate selection of simulation modalities.
- Support development and training of Simulated Participants ensuring accurate portrayal clinical realism and learner-centered feedback.
- Support assessment activities including development and implementation of evaluation tools and checklists.
- Scheduling Compliance & Reporting
- Monitor scheduling and availability of simulation spaces equipment and technical resources; proactively identify and communicate conflicts.
- Support adherence to IPSC and SHS policies and procedures and ensure alignment with Healthcare Simulation Standards of Best Practice.
- Maintain documentation and reporting requirements including annual reports and accrediting or professional organization submissions (e.g. Society for Simulation in Healthcare).
- Maintain awareness of accreditation requirements relevant to supported programs.
- Strategic Growth & Innovation
- Stay informed of advancements in simulation and educational technology relevant to health professions education.
- Conduct vendor scans and recommend equipment investments or upgrades to support program growth and innovation.
- Support operational planning for expansion of simulation services as new SHS programs are added to the Charlotte campus.
- Supports the planning and phased development of a Standardized Patient (SP) program with responsibility for assisting in future SP recruitment training case preparation and quality assurance as simulation activities and program needs expand.
